This table ornament is an ode to the Earth and all that it brings forth, as well as an unsurpassed display of artistic and technical skill. The stem of the dish represents Mother Earth. She is surrounded by flowers, herbs and small animals – all cast from specimens collected in the wild. The lives of actual animals were sacrificed to model the young grass snakes and lizards.
